Class GitLabBranchBuild
- java.lang.Object
-
- hudson.model.AbstractDescribableImpl<GitLabBranchBuild>
-
- com.dabsquared.gitlabjenkins.workflow.GitLabBranchBuild
-
- All Implemented Interfaces:
Describable<GitLabBranchBuild>
public class GitLabBranchBuild extends AbstractDescribableImpl<GitLabBranchBuild>
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
GitLabBranchBuild.DescriptorImpl
-
Constructor Summary
Constructors Constructor Description GitLabBranchBuild()
GitLabBranchBuild(String projectId, String revisionHash)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description GitLabConnectionProperty
getConnection()
String
getName()
String
getProjectId()
String
getRevisionHash()
void
setConnection(GitLabConnectionProperty connection)
void
setConnection(String connection)
void
setName(String name)
void
setProjectId(String projectId)
void
setRevisionHash(String revisionHash)
-
Methods inherited from class hudson.model.AbstractDescribableImpl
getDescriptor
-
-
-
-
Method Detail
-
setName
@DataBoundSetter public void setName(String name)
-
setProjectId
@DataBoundSetter public void setProjectId(String projectId)
-
setRevisionHash
@DataBoundSetter public void setRevisionHash(String revisionHash)
-
setConnection
@DataBoundSetter public void setConnection(GitLabConnectionProperty connection)
-
setConnection
public void setConnection(String connection)
-
getName
public String getName()
-
getProjectId
public String getProjectId()
-
getRevisionHash
public String getRevisionHash()
-
getConnection
public GitLabConnectionProperty getConnection()
-
-